Chelsea Football Club Chair Stays – Skadden Arps Position Goes

Bruce Buck, the man who chairs the Chelsea Football Club and is also a partner at mega-firm Skadden Arps Slate Meagher & Flom, is to step down from his position with the law firm’s London office. Former Guatemalan Officer Gets 10 Years’ Prison For Lying About Role in Massacre

  RIVERSIDE, California – A former Guatemalan Special Forces officer was sentenced today to serve 10 years in federal prison for covering up his involvement in the 1982 massacre of nearly everyone in the village of Dos Erres, Guatemala. Jorge Sosa, 55, of Moreno Valley, received the statutory maximum sentence of 120 months in prison
